The Kanakagiri constituency witnessed an interesting fight in the 2023 assembly election. The voters exercised their voting franchise and 78.31% of voting was recorded in this constituency..

| Year | Candidate's Name | Votes | Lead | Vote Share |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2023 | Shivaraj Sangappa Thangadagi | INC | 106,164 | 42,632 | 60% |
| 2018 | Basavaraj Dadesugur | BJP | 87,735 | 14,225 | 52% |
| 2013 | Shivaraj Sangappatangadagi | INC | 49,451 | 5,052 | 53% |
| 2008 | Shivaraj S/o Sangappa Tangadagi | IND | 32,743 | 2,183 | 52% |
| 2004 | Veerappa Devappa Kesarahatti G | BJP | 46,712 | 5,576 | 53% |
| 1999 | M Malikarjun Nagappa | INC | 55,808 | 23,207 | 63% |
| 1994 | Nagappa Bheemappa Saloni | JD | 32,238 | 193 | 50% |
| 1989 | M. Mallikarjuna | INC | 39,812 | 9,533 | 57% |
| 1985 | Srirangadevarayalu | INC | 29,791 | 663 | 51% |
| 1983 | Srirangadevarayalu Venkarayalu | INC | 25,992 | 20,363 | 82% |
| 1978 | M.nagappa Mukappa | INC(I) | 27,932 | 15,008 | 68% |

Shivaraj Sangappa Thangadagi of the Indian National Congress (INC) won the Kanakagiri Assembly seat in the 2023 elections, defeating Basavaraj Dadesaguru of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) by a margin of 42632 votes.
The strike rate in the Kanakagiri constituency is 67% INC and 33% BJP, with INC won 2 times and BJP won 1 time since the 2008 elections.
